Product Name Anti-Cytokeratin/Keratin K19 Monoclonal Antibody
Description The protein encoded by this gene is a member of the keratin family. The keratins are intermediate filament proteins responsible for the structural integrity of epithelial cells and are subdivided into cytokeratins and hair keratins. The type I cytokeratins consist of acidic proteins which are arranged in pairs of heterotypic keratin chains. Unlike its related family members, this smallest known acidic cytokeratin is not paired with a basic cytokeratin in epithelial cells. It is specifically expressed in the periderm, the transiently superficial layer that envelopes the developing epidermis. The type I cytokeratins are clustered in a region of chromosome 17q12-q21. Mouse Monoclonal Antibody to Cytokeratin/Keratin K19, human
Synonyms CK19, K19, K1CS
Clonality Monoclonal
Clone RCK108
Immunogen Human Bladder Cell Line T24
Isotype IgG1
Specificity Mab RCK108 specifically reacts with cytokeratin/keratin K19 (40 kDa protein in immunoblotting), found in most simple and non-keratinized stratified epithelia.
Reactivity Human
Applications IHC, WB
Form Hyberidoma culture Supernatant
Storage 2-8C
References Smedts, F. et al. (1990) Am. J. Pathol., 136: 657-668
